Q 1. Describe the phases of a typical amphibious assault.
A typical amphibious assault unfolds in several distinct phases, each crucial for success. Think of it like a carefully choreographed play with multiple acts. These phases are often fluid and overlapping, adapting to the specific circumstances of the operation.
- Planning and Reconnaissance: This initial phase involves meticulous intelligence gathering, target analysis, and detailed planning for every aspect of the operation – from logistics and troop deployments to communication and potential enemy responses. This stage often includes reconnaissance missions, potentially utilizing special forces or unmanned aerial vehicles (UAVs).
- Embarkation and Movement to the Objective: This involves loading troops, equipment, and supplies onto landing craft and ships, followed by the transit to the designated landing area. This phase requires precise coordination between the naval and amphibious forces, accounting for weather, sea state, and enemy activity.
- Approach and Assault: The assault phase is the most dynamic. Landing craft approach the beach under naval gunfire support and air cover. Waves of assault troops, often utilizing specialized landing craft, storm the beach to secure a foothold. This necessitates close coordination between different units and the swift establishment of beachheads.
- Beachhead Consolidation and Expansion: Once a beachhead is established, it needs to be secured and expanded. Reinforcements arrive, defenses are built up, and the area is prepared for the main force to come ashore. This involves engineering capabilities, logistics support, and clearing any potential obstacles.
- Advance to the Objective: Finally, the forces advance inland, pushing toward their ultimate objective, whether that’s a port city or a strategic location. This is the concluding phase, building on the success of the previous phases and often integrating with follow-on operations.
For example, the Normandy landings (D-Day) in World War II illustrate these phases perfectly, with extensive planning, a complex movement to the objective, a massive assault, a challenging beachhead consolidation, and a subsequent inland advance.

Q 5. Describe different types of landing craft and their capabilities.
Various landing craft are tailored for specific roles in amphibious operations, each with unique capabilities. Think of them as specialized vehicles within an army, each having a distinct purpose.
- LCU (Landing Craft, Utility): These are large, versatile craft capable of transporting significant amounts of cargo and personnel. They are often used for transporting heavier equipment and providing logistical support.
- LCAC (Landing Craft, Air Cushion): These high-speed, hovercraft can operate in shallow water and over beaches, allowing for rapid deployment of troops and equipment, even in challenging terrain.
- LCVP (Landing Craft, Vehicle, Personnel): Smaller and faster than LCUs, these are primarily used for transporting troops and light vehicles directly onto the beach.
- LST (Landing Ship, Tank): Larger than landing craft, these ships carry and deploy tanks and other heavy vehicles directly onto the shore. They’re essentially floating mobile bases.
- LCM (Landing Craft, Mechanized): These are relatively smaller landing craft, specifically designed for transporting mechanized infantry and their vehicles.
The choice of landing craft depends on various factors such as the type of cargo, beach conditions, and the overall operational plan.

Q 15. What are the environmental factors that need to be considered in amphibious operations?
Environmental factors are paramount in amphibious operations, impacting everything from planning to execution. They can be broadly categorized into:
- Sea State: Wave height, current speed and direction, and visibility significantly affect landing craft maneuverability and troop disembarkation. A heavy sea state can make landings impossible or extremely dangerous. For example, during the Normandy landings, the unexpectedly rough seas caused delays and casualties.
- Weather: Fog, rain, strong winds, and storms dramatically reduce visibility, hindering navigation, air support, and overall coordination. Poor weather can also damage equipment and impact troop morale.
- Tidal Conditions: The timing of high and low tides dictates the accessibility of beaches and landing zones. This is crucial for selecting optimal landing times and minimizing exposure to enemy fire. A poorly timed assault could leave landing craft stranded or expose troops to unfavorable terrain.
- Bathymetry (Seafloor Topography): The depth, slope, and composition of the seabed affect the approach and landing of vessels. Shallow water or submerged obstacles pose significant risks to landing craft and personnel. Detailed bathymetric surveys are therefore essential in planning.
- Water Temperature: Extreme water temperatures can impact personnel survival if they are unexpectedly in the water for extended periods. This is especially important for the health and wellbeing of troops.
Understanding and accurately predicting these factors is crucial for mission success. Advanced meteorological and oceanographic modeling plays a vital role in mitigating risks.

Q 17. What are the key factors influencing the timing of an amphibious assault?
The timing of an amphibious assault is influenced by a complex interplay of factors:
- Tide and Current: As discussed earlier, favorable tidal conditions are essential for safe and efficient landings. The timing of high tide might dictate the assault’s start time.
- Weather: Favorable weather is crucial for visibility, air support, and the overall safety of the operation. Poor weather can lead to significant delays or even cancellation.
- Enemy Activity: Intelligence suggests optimal times to minimize enemy resistance, possibly capitalizing on periods of reduced alertness or shifts in guard duty. This is a highly sensitive aspect that depends on intelligence gathering.
- Lunar Phase: The amount of light available at night can be a consideration, particularly for night assaults. A full moon may provide better visibility for the assault force, but may also provide better visibility to the defending forces.
- Logistics: The availability of transport, supplies, and reinforcement elements dictate a realistic timeframe. Logistics must support the timing selected.
Optimal timing is a balancing act. The goal is to select a time window that maximizes the chances of success while minimizing risks. This often involves a complex process of risk assessment and decision making using all available information.

Q 25. What are the ethical considerations in amphibious warfare?
Ethical considerations in amphibious warfare are multifaceted and demand rigorous attention to detail. The principles of distinction, proportionality, and precaution are fundamental.
- Distinction: Differentiating between combatants and non-combatants is paramount. We must ensure that our actions target only legitimate military objectives and avoid harming civilians or civilian infrastructure.
- Proportionality: The anticipated military advantage must outweigh the expected civilian harm. An operation that results in significant civilian casualties, even if it achieves a military objective, may be considered ethically questionable.
- Precaution: We must take all feasible precautions to avoid civilian casualties and minimize collateral damage. This includes intelligence gathering, reconnaissance, and utilizing precision-guided munitions where possible.
- Accountability: Mechanisms for investigating alleged violations of the laws of war and holding those responsible accountable are essential for upholding ethical standards.
- Respect for Human Rights: Protecting the human rights of the civilian population is paramount, including the right to life, liberty, and security of person.
Ethical dilemmas frequently arise in complex operational environments. For example, the use of force in densely populated areas requires careful consideration of proportionality and precaution. Regular ethical reviews and compliance with international humanitarian law are crucial for ensuring our actions are morally justified.
Q 26. Describe your experience with different amphibious doctrine and tactics.
My experience encompasses various amphibious doctrines and tactics, ranging from traditional ship-to-shore assaults to more modern, combined arms approaches.
- Traditional Assault: This involves a large-scale, coordinated landing of troops and equipment from ships onto a beachhead, often supported by naval gunfire and air power. This tactic, while effective in certain situations, is vulnerable to concentrated enemy fire.
- Vertical Envelopment: This utilizes helicopters and other vertical lift assets to deploy troops behind enemy lines, bypassing heavily defended beachheads. This approach requires significant airlift capability but can be highly effective in disrupting enemy defenses.
- Combined Arms Approach: This integrates various military branches, including the navy, army, air force, and marines, in a coordinated effort. This allows for the flexible use of different weapons systems and tactics, adapting to specific circumstances.
- Littoral Warfare: This focuses on operations in the coastal areas and shallow waters, utilizing a range of platforms, including ships, helicopters, and amphibious vehicles. This demands a high level of coordination and adaptability.
I’ve been involved in operations employing different combinations of these doctrines and tactics, adapting our approach based on the specific operational environment, the enemy’s capabilities, and the mission’s objectives. Each approach requires careful planning and a thorough understanding of the capabilities and limitations of various assets.

Q 28. What are some examples of historical amphibious operations and what lessons can be learned from them?
Many historical amphibious operations offer valuable lessons. Let’s look at a few:
- Normandy Landings (D-Day): A massive success, but also highlighting the importance of meticulous planning, overwhelming firepower, and effective deception. The lessons learned involved the need for comprehensive intelligence gathering, coordinated air and naval support, and robust logistical planning. The high casualties also underscore the inherent risks of large-scale amphibious assaults.
- Inchon Landing (Korean War): A daring and successful amphibious landing that dramatically altered the course of the war. The lesson here is the potential for audacious and unconventional tactics to achieve unexpected results, but it also highlights the importance of accurate intelligence and a clear understanding of the operational environment.
- Tarawa (World War II): A costly operation that demonstrated the importance of thorough reconnaissance and the devastating effects of concentrated enemy fire on unprepared landings. This operation emphasized the necessity of pre-assault bombardment and the need to carefully select landing sites.
- Operation Urgent Fury (Grenada): This operation demonstrated the importance of having a clearly defined objective, even in a small-scale amphibious assault. The operation also highlighted the challenges of operating in unfamiliar terrain and the need for robust communication and coordination between different military branches.
Analyzing these operations, we gain insights into the critical success factors, potential pitfalls, and the ever-evolving nature of amphibious warfare. Each operation provides unique lessons that contribute to the refinement of doctrines, tactics, and planning processes for future operations.
